Zephyrnet-logo

Hoe Ledger's implementatie van miniscript voor Bitcoin een wereld aan mogelijkheden opent | Grootboek

Datum:

Dingen om te weten:
– Ledger-apparaten zijn de eerste hardwareportefeuilles die Miniscript voor Bitcoin implementeren, wat onze ambitie benadrukt om voorop te blijven lopen op het gebied van Bitcoin-innovatie. 

– Hoewel Ledger-gebruikers momenteel Bitcoin kunnen 'verzenden' en 'ontvangen', legt Ledger's implementatie van Miniscript voor Bitcoin de basis om gebruikers in staat te stellen flexibele en op maat gemaakte regels in te stellen voor Bitcoin-transacties.

– U kunt meer informatie vinden over hoe Ledger Miniscript voor Bitcoin gebruikt door dit te lezen blog geschreven door Salvatore Ingala, Bitcoin-software-ingenieur bij Ledger.

Ledger-apparaten zijn de eerste hardwareportefeuilles die Miniscript voor Bitcoin implementeren, wat onze toewijding benadrukt om nieuwe functies te adopteren zodra ze beschikbaar zijn, zoals we hebben gedaan met Taproot, dat we vanaf dag één ondersteunden. In dit artikel leg ik uit hoe Miniscript belooft Bitcoin-transacties te veranderen, en hoe we van plan zijn deze baanbrekende technologie te gebruiken om onze gebruikers de beste ervaring te bieden.

Wat Bitcoin Miniscript op tafel brengt

Bitcoin Miniscript is een taal op hoog niveau voor het uitdrukken van Bitcoin Script, ontworpen en geïmplementeerd door Pieter Wuille, Andrew Poelstra en Sanket Kanjalkar bij Blockstream Research. Het wordt sinds versie 25.0 ondersteund in Bitcoin Core, dankzij het werk van Antoine Poinsot van WizardSardine.

In tegenstelling tot traditionele Bitcoin-scripts die afhankelijk zijn van strenge regels, maakt Miniscript gebruik van een dynamischer en aanpasbaar raamwerk. In dit opzicht vertegenwoordigt Miniscript voor Bitcoin een aanzienlijke sprong voorwaarts, waarbij op maat gemaakte bestedingsvoorwaarden worden gecreëerd die beter zijn aangepast aan de specifieke gebruikersbehoeften. 

Miniscript voor Bitcoin maakt dit bijvoorbeeld mogelijk meer geavanceerde multisig-portefeuilles en betere bescherming tegen enkele storingspunten. Dit is met name gunstig voor scenario's waarin meerdere partijen transacties moeten autoriseren, zoals bedrijfsobligaties of gezamenlijke rekeningen, zoals Ledger's CTO Charles Guillemet schetsen in deze publicatie. Iets anders dat u kunt doen met een portemonnee met Miniscript is het maken van portemonnees waaraan na een vooraf bepaalde tijd een andere partij wordt toegevoegd. Stel je voor dat een portemonnee een 2-van-2 is (bijvoorbeeld twee bedrijfsmanagers); na zes maanden kan het bij onenigheid een 2-op-3 worden tussen dezelfde twee managers en een advocaat.

Miniscript voor Bitcoin maakt ook tijdgebonden transacties mogelijk. Een interessante use case betreft het domein van overerving. Stel dat u zes maanden geleden voor het laatst uw geld heeft overgemaakt. Met een Bitcoin-portemonnee met Miniscript kunnen uw erfgenamen er na deze bepaalde periode automatisch toegang toe krijgen. Na een bepaalde periode kan een toewijzing voor uw drie kinderen worden geregeld, en na een jaar kan een notaris toegang krijgen tot het geld als hij het er niet mee eens is of om welke reden dan ook niet bij het geld kan.

Tijdgebonden portemonnee-back-up is een andere interessante toepassing. Stel dat u uw primaire sleutel (of sleutels als het een multi-sig is) kwijtraakt. Met een portemonnee met Miniscript-functionaliteit zou er na zes maanden een extra manier beschikbaar kunnen komen om geld uit te geven. Miniscript is ook een manier om ‘vertrouwde geassisteerde hechtenis’ uit te voeren. Stel je voor dat je belangrijkste bestedingstraject de sleutel van een (semi-vertrouwde) dienst vereist, maar na een vooraf bepaalde periode kun je de munten zonder de dienst uitgeven. Tegenwoordig is er een interessante toepassing Liaan, een Bitcoin-portemonnee die gebruikmaakt van on-chain tijdsloten voor veiligheid en herstel, waardoor u uw bezittingen veilig aan uw begunstigden kunt nalaten.

Gecombineerd hebben dergelijke gebruiksscenario’s het potentieel om meer mogelijkheden aan het Bitcoin-netwerk te bieden en een wereld van gebruiksscenario’s te openen die nog voor ons liggen. In dit opzicht zou onze ondersteuning van Miniscript voor Bitcoin gebruikers veel meer kunnen laten doen met hun beveiligde apparaten.

Slotopmerkingen

Wat we vandaag de dag zien met Bitcoin Miniscript is slechts het topje van de ijsberg. Naarmate deze scripttaal steeds meer terrein wint, verwachten we dat er een uitgebreider scala aan gebruiksscenario’s zal ontstaan ​​die Bitcoin-gebruikers concrete bruikbaarheid zullen bieden. Bij Ledger zullen we altijd voorop blijven lopen in deze evoluties om de meest geavanceerde en veilige diensten aan onze groeiende gemeenschap van gebruikers te bieden.

spot_img

Laatste intelligentie

spot_img